#63625e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#63625e is composed of 38.8% red, 38.4%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1% magenta, 5.1%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 48 degrees, a saturation of 2.6% and a lightness of 37.8%. #63625e color hex could be obtained by blending #c6c4bc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#63625e color description : Very dark grayish yellow.

#63625e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#63625e has RGB values of R:99, G:98,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.01, Y:0.05,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 6513246.

Shades and Tints of #63625e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080808 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fd is the lightest one.
